A home care service provider in Bradford is looking for a dedicated Home Care Assistant. The role involves providing personal care, companionship, and support to clients in their own homes. Applicants must demonstrate empathy, effective communication, and a compassionate approach.

Duties include:

  • Meal preparation
  • Assisting with personal care needs, where ensuring dignity and respect are paramount

Flexibility with shifts is essential, as weekend work is required.
